underling
Meanings
Plural: underlings
Noun
- an assistant subject to the authority or control of another
- A subordinate, or person of lesser rank or authority.
- A low, wretched person.
Origin / Etymology
From Middle English underling, from Old English underling, equivalent to under + -ling.
Synonyms
foot soldier, subordinate, subsidiary
